Looks like calibre 3 has made a huge leap with docx conversion!

Footnotes now work as hyperlinks!

I do have one problem though.
I have two books. Both covered from AZW3 to DOCX, and both have hyperlinked endnotes.
In Word 2016, the hyperlinked endnotes work fine for both books.
However, when importing the DOCX file into Logos 7, the hyperlinks are broken with one of the books, but work fine with the other.

I noticed that the hyperlinks are linked to word bookmarks...?
The problem seems to be associated with the naming of the bookmarks.
The book which has working hyperlinks in Logos is the one that has bookmarks composed of all digits, or at least starts with a digit (e.g. "11_9" however, Office Word does not allow bookmarks that start with a digit...). The other book has bookmarks which starts with a letter and combines letters and digits in the name (e.g. "pich02_fn2").
Although, I am not sure if this is the real issue.


Would it be possible to add a feature to caliber that converts all internal bookmarks/hyperlinks names to a consistent numbering system (i.e. 1, 2, 3, 4 .... 114332)?
